Having a raindrop water fountain for cats is an excellent way to keep your feline friend hydrated, entertained and healthy. However, like any other pet product, regular maintenance and cleaning are essential for optimal functionality and hygiene. In this article, we will go through the steps you need to take to keep your raindrop water fountain for cats clean and healthy.
The first step in cleaning your raindrop water fountain for cats is to unplug the power cord and remove the pump from the fountain. Most raindrop water fountains for cats come with removable and washable parts, making the cleaning process straightforward. Here are steps to follow when cleaning your fountain:
Step 1: Disassemble the fountain
To properly clean your raindrop water fountain for cats, you need to disassemble it into separate parts. This includes the top and the bottom part and the pump. Refer to your user manual to ensure that you correctly disassemble and reassemble the unit.
Step 2: Scrub the water fountain
After disassembling, you can now scrub the fountain with clean water and a mild soap or cleaning solution. Use a soft-bristled brush to scrub any dirt, grime, or debris. Be sure to clean under the water pump, in the corners and crevices where dirt and gunk may accumulate.
Step 3: Rinse the fountain
Once you have scrubbed and cleaned the parts thoroughly, rinse every part you have scrubbed in fresh water. Be sure to rinse the fountain thoroughly to remove any soap or cleaning solution.
Step 4: Clean the filter
If your raindrop water fountain for cats comes with a filter, you need to clean the filter thoroughly or replace it if necessary. Follow the user manual’s guidelines to ensure that you are properly cleaning or replacing the filter.
Step 5: Reassemble the fountain
After cleaning every part, reassemble the fountain. Before using the fountain, make sure that each part is properly in place, and all fittings are tight.
Step 6: Turn on the fountain
Plug in the fountain, and turn it on to make sure everything works fine. Ensure that the water flow rate is steady and that the pump is not producing any unusual sounds. Run the fountain with clean water for five minutes to rinse out any remaining detergent or cleaning solution.
In conclusion, cleaning your raindrop water fountain for cats is essential for optimal hygiene and functionality. Follow the above steps to ensure that you keep your pet’s fountain clean and healthy. Additionally, clean the fountain regularly, at least once a week, and change the water frequently to avoid bacterial growth. By doing so, you will keep your cat healthy and hydrated while enjoying their fountain.
